"Mount Fuji from Sukiya Bridge 1858" . . . The snow covered waterfront and Sukiya Bridge, in the eastern capital. Travelers and porters cross the bridge among buildings and boats. A view of Mount Fuji in the background. A page of the series, 'Fuji Sanjurokkei' (36 views of Mount Fuji). From an original 19th century (1858) woodcut, 'Toto Sukiyabashi' (Sukiya Bridge in the Eastern Capital), by Ando Hiroshige. All Rights Reserved © 2013 padre art . . .
